    IBF has set 5x7 for all international junior events and all Grand Prix
    events this year. Unless major glitch is found looks likely that there
    will be general switch next year or so.

    Rules are the same as now except:

    5 games to 7 points
    set to 8 at 6 (optional of course)
    90 sec break between all games with coaching allowed. Can't leave
    the court with permission of the umpire. NO 5 minute break.
    change sides at 4 in the 5th game.

    USAB requires 5x7 for all junior events this year and recommends it for others.
    Junior Nationals is 5x7.

    USAB will push out 5x7 when IBF does. All signs are that this will be next year.
